Kaduna SSG Holds Strategic Engagement with NASRDA to Strengthen Development and Revenue Generation

The Secretary to the Kaduna State Government, Dr. Abdulkadir Mu'azu Mayere, convened a strategic engagement with officials of the National Space Research and Development Agency (NASRDA) to explore opportunities for collaboration aimed at advancing sustainable development and improving internally generated revenue in Kaduna State.

Speaking during the meeting, Dr. Mayere stated that the engagement was organized to enable NASRDA present its range of services and technical capabilities, with a view to identifying areas where the Kaduna State Government can establish strategic partnerships to support the state's development agenda.

He emphasized the government's commitment to leveraging innovative technologies and institutional partnerships that will enhance service delivery, promote economic growth, and improve governance across key sectors.

The meeting brought together relevant Ministries, Departments, and Agencies (MDAs), including the Ministry of Agriculture, Ministry of Education, Ministry of Environment, Ministry of Public Works and Infrastructure, Kaduna Geographic Information Service (KADGIS), and the Kaduna State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B), to deliberate on practical areas of collaboration.

In his presentation, the Acting Director of Space Enterprise at NASRDA, Dr. Idris Jega, highlighted the immense potential of space technology in driving socio economic development. He explained that integrating space based technologies into government planning and operations would significantly enhance decision making, improve resource management, strengthen public service delivery, and substantially boost the state's internally generated revenue.

Kaduna SSG Hosts Meeting of Northern States' Secretaries to the Government

The Secretary to the Kaduna State Government, Dr. Abdulkadir Mu'azu Mayere, is hosting the meeting of the 19 Northern States' Secretaries to the State Government (SSGs) ahead of the Northern Governors' Forum meeting scheduled to hold tomorrow in Kaduna.

The meeting is convened to harmonise and prepare key agenda items for consideration by the Northern Governors during their deliberations.

As chief advisers and principal coordinators of government business in their respective states, the Secretaries to the State Governments meet periodically to review critical regional issues, align policy positions, and strengthen intergovernmental collaboration in support of the Northern Governors' Forum.

The meeting is attended by the Secretaries to the State Governments from the 19 Northern states, alongside other designated government representatives.

SSG COMMENDS SENATOR UBA SANI'S ₦34 BILLION RIGASA EROSION CONTROL PROJECT AS A LANDMARK ACHIEVEMENT

By Comrade Adams

The foundation of every prosperous society lies in its ability to protect lives, preserve the environment, and invest in sustainable infrastructure. This vision is being translated into reality by the Executive Governor of Kaduna State, Senator Uba Sani, whose administration has flagged off the ₦34 billion Rigasa Erosion Control Project in Rigasa, Igabi Local Government Area.

Designed to permanently address more than three decades of devastating erosion, the project will safeguard lives, restore degraded land, and protect critical infrastructure. It is expected to directly benefit over two million residents, while more than ₦2 billion has been earmarked for the compensation and resettlement of over 1,200 affected households, reflecting an administration that places the welfare of its people at the center of development.

Kaduna SSG Urges Citizens to Shun Gender Based Violence.

The Secretary to the Kaduna State Government, Dr. Abdulkadir Mu’azu Mayere, has urged citizens to shun gender-based violence.

Dr. Mayere said this during a one-day lecture organized by the Advocates For Violence Free Society And Peaceful Coexistence Initiative Nigeria (AVSAPCIN).

Represented by the Permanent Secretary, Special Duties, Mr. Augustine Godwin Alex, he stated in a goodwill message that the programme is both timely and relevant, as gender-based violence remains a significant challenge to social harmony, human dignity, and sustainable development.

He added that a stable society can only thrive when the rights of citizens are respected and protected, regardless of gender, age, or social status.

Dr. Mayere commended the organisers for creating a platform for dialogue, enlightenment, and collective action. He expressed hope that the discussions and recommendations from the lecture will contribute meaningfully to the promotion of justice, equality, peace, and security in communities. He encouraged all participants to engage actively and take the lessons learned back to their respective peers of influence.

He further noted that the Governor Uba Sani administration is highly committed to ensuring every citizen is given equal rights regardless of gender.

In attendance were several human rights organizations, community leaders, and students from public schools, among other participants.
